Transaction aed86b4a60ba4d999f9198d8a06a80becc26ca22171938bbf55d8fbe99d03ae9
1 Input
1 Output
-
aed86b4a60ba4d999f9198d8a06a80becc26ca22171938bbf55d8fbe99d03ae9:0
- value
- 3833249
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7c5c306a1b4738187358208899f91887ed7e04c
- address
- bc1q6lzuxp4pk3ecrpe4sgygn8u33pld0czvurvdy2